Good food doesn't always have to be expensive - even for little money you can get tasty dishes in Bonn. Whether schnitzel, Italian or more unusual creations, we have put together some restaurants where you can eat for less than ten euros.

BurritoRico

The restaurant with Mexican-Californian cuisine is located in the immediate vicinity of the main train station and Friedensplatz. It offers burritos, quesadillas, tacos and nachos. When you order, you can decide on the individual ingredients and, if you wish, omit or add one or two, as the staff always prepare the dishes fresh.

Opening hours: Monday to Friday: 12 to 10 p.m., Saturday: 12:30 to 10 p.m., Sunday: 1 to 9 p.m.

Address: Thomas-Mann-Strasse 20, 53111 Bonn, Germany

Cafeteria Nassestraße

The main canteen of the University of Bonn on Nassestraße offers cheap food for students, but also for everyone else. Non-students only pay a small surcharge. In addition to the daily offers, there are vegetarian and vegan dishes. For the small appetite, Café Eleven on the ground floor offers coffee and other snacks. There is various entertainment such as sports broadcasts and live music on a regular basis. In October 2017, the cafeteria even received an award from the animal welfare organization Peta for its vegan offerings.

Opening hours Mensa: Monday to Friday: 11:30 am to 7:30 pm, Saturday: 12 to 1:45 pm

Opening hours Café Eleven: Monday to Friday: 8 to 8 p.m., Saturday: 10 to 3 p.m. (without Bundesliga), 10 to 6 p.m. (with Bundesliga), in the semester holidays separate opening hours apply.

Address: Nassestraße 11, 53113 Bonn, Germany

Website: Studentenwerk
